Eli Lilly And Co

Eli Lilly (LLY) trades at $1,185.71, down 0.59% on the day, with a bullish technical signal from moving averages and strong fundamental momentum. The company reported Q2 2026 revenue growth of 48% to $23 billion, beating estimates, driven by demand for Mounjaro and Zepbound. Valuation ratios like P/E of 39.8 and P/S of 13.34 reflect high growth expectations, while profitability remains robust with a net income margin of 33.53%.

Outlook is positive due to pipeline advancements like retatrutide and raised 2026 guidance, but risks include competitive pressures and regulatory scrutiny. Analysts are bullish with a consensus price target of $1,380, citing sustained double-digit growth and market leadership in weight-loss drugs as key drivers for upside.

About Hasbro, Inc.

Hasbro is a branded play company providing children and families around the world with entertainment offerings based on a world-class brand portfolio. From toys and games to television programming, motion pictures, and a licensing program, Hasbro reaches customers by leveraging its well-known brands such as Transformers, Nerf, and Magic: The Gathering. Ownership stakes in Discovery Family, which offers programming around Hasbro brands, and owned production capabilities from Entertainment One help bolster Hasbro's multichannel presence. The firm acquired Entertainment One in 2019, bolting on popular properties like Peppa Pig and PJ Masks, and has plans to tie up with Dungeons & Dragons Beyond in 2022, offering the firm access 10 million digital tabletop players.
